2004 Chevrolet Impala vs. 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om
To start off,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Chevrolet Impala.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Chevrolet Impala would be higher. At 6,749 cc (12 cylinders), 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om (448 HP @ 5350 RPM) has 248 more horse power than 2004 Chevrolet Impala. (200 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om should accelerate faster than 2004 Chevrolet Impala.
Because 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Chevrolet Impala,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om (531 Nm) has 226 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Chevrolet Impala. (305 Nm). This means 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Chevrolet Impala.
Compare all specifications:
2004 Chevrolet Impala | 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om | |
Make | Chevrolet | Rolls-Royce |
Model | Impala | Phantom |
Year Released | 2004 | 2009 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3786 cc | 6749 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 12 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 200 HP | 448 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5350 RPM |
Torque | 305 Nm | 531 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 97.1 mm | 92 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86 mm | 84.6 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.4:1 | 11.1:1 |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 5090 mm | 5840 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 2000 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1640 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2880 mm | 3580 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 7.8 L/100km | 9.6 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.8 L/100km | 19.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9.8 L/100km | 16.1 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 64 L | 100 L |
